Output a66fef627fd2c96b6e10e4545059b9b35786f6f439dae4032bfc23217163d0bc:0

value
2000000
script pubkey
OP_0 OP_PUSHBYTES_20 ce5131d83270435fa14b639ae7264b8a333f7848
address
bc1qeegnrkpjwpp4lg2tvwdwwfjt3gen77zg5tr6x3
transaction
a66fef627fd2c96b6e10e4545059b9b35786f6f439dae4032bfc23217163d0bc
confirmations
47169
spent
false

2 Sat Ranges